Output 39fbe1dcd296a0a7fed624f78351c5b6a385ef8c857dd7d7f1d673bbcdecbadc:1

value
4869
script pubkey
OP_0 OP_PUSHBYTES_20 edf5e06c73b33e5bb3b5678a0a9e50adb62bac4e
address
bc1qah67qmrnkvl9hva4v79q48js4kmzhtzwzupetk
transaction
39fbe1dcd296a0a7fed624f78351c5b6a385ef8c857dd7d7f1d673bbcdecbadc
confirmations
100576
spent
true